Jakarta (Antara Bali) - The Indonesian currency  rupiah traded  at 9,550 per dollar on Thursday morning weakening 20 points from 9,530 on yesterday's closing.

Market observer Lana Soelistianingsih of Samuel Sekuritas, said  here Thursday the rupiah value tended to be bearish against the US dollar, but Bank Indonesia (BI) is expected to prevent the currency from falling deeper.

"With the central bank on its defense, the rupiah would move in a narrow space," Lana said.

She  predicted  the US economy would not be as bad as many had feared amid shrinking exports and economic recession in Europe.

"The US economy grew 1.7 percent  year on year in the second quarter of 2012  after a 2 percent growth YOY  in the previous quarter," she said.(IGT)
